“…All glucanases exhibit a similar activity profile at high temperatures, with an optimum around 60 °C (Figure 22b). This aligns with the natural response of T. thermophilus, which thrives in conditions of growth set between 50-60 °C in acidic environment, and with previous works on native 111 and recombinant enzymes 113,114 produced and characterized from this organism.…”
